Crescent Moon Games

Crescent Moon Games official Youtube Channel!
Great indie games for iOS/Android/Mac/PC


2:48

Shared 1 year ago

405 views

0:33

Shared 3 years ago

238 views

1:18

Shared 4 years ago

1.1K views

1:06

Shared 5 years ago

7.9K views

1:47

Shared 5 years ago

2.5K views

0:29

Shared 6 years ago

3.1K views

1:03

Shared 6 years ago

2.4K views